Dear Colleagues,

Coating plays a crucial role in enhancing the performance, durability, and functionality of materials across various industries, including automotive, aerospace, energy, biomedical and manufacturing sectors. Advances in coating technologies have led to the development of high-performance materials with exceptional mechanical, electrical, thermal and bio-chemical properties.

This Special Issue highlights the latest research and innovations in coatings for advanced applications. It explores state-of-the-art developments in high-performance coatings, focusing on their development, properties, and applications. Additionally, novel insights into electrodeposition techniques for functional coatings will be covered, including research trends in electrochemical synthesis and hybrid coatings.

Topics of interest include, but are not limited to, the following:

  • Advances in deposition techniques such as CVD, PVD, ALD, laser cladding and electrodeposition for wear resistance, sensing, catalysis and thermal stability.
  • Carbon-based materials (diamond, graphene, CNT-based, and diamond-like carbon) for superior wear resistance, conductivity, and biocompatibility.
  • Ceramic coatings for high-performance applications in automotive, construction, electronics, aerospace and defense.
  • Biomedical coatings, including bioactive, antimicrobial, and biocompatible coatings for medical implants, prosthetics and drug delivery systems.
  • Multifunctional and hybrid coating systems.
